Bayern Munich’s astonishing season continues as they beat Leverkusen and book their place in the German Cup final, where they will face the winner of Stuttgart-Freiburg.
The winning goal once again came from the usual Harry Kane, created by the Musiala-Diaz link-up: the Englishman controls it slightly off-center and smashes it under the crossbar with absurd precision.
Tonight’s goal is his 57th of the season, an astonishing number that rises to 63 if we include assists as well. Truly Ballon d’Or-worthy numbers.
Leverkusen never really trouble Bayern: in the first half they do not produce a single shot on target, while late on, as they try a desperate assault, they are picked off by Bayern’s other devil, Luis Diaz.
For Bayern, it is a place in the cup final and a chance to win it for the 20th time, with the dream of a treble more alive and realistic than ever.
